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ement

  1.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Opening the device: шаг 1, изображение 1 из 1
    • Start by unscrewing the bottom case. There are two different size screws. One long one short.

    • The ones marked in red are the short ones. As for the ones in orange are the long ones.

  2.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Unplugging the Battery: шаг 2, изображение 1 из 2 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Unplugging the Battery: шаг 2, изображение 2 из 2
    • Using a plastic spudger push back the retaining clasp for the battery plug. It is a sliding motion so push it to the right with the battery closest to you.

  3.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Removing the cooler: шаг 3, изображение 1 из 1
    • Marked in red and orange are the screws that hold on the cooler. They are all the same size but I would still keep track of if it was holding on a fan or a block.

    • Marked in yellow are the power and signal wires for the fans. Using a plastic spudger slowly walk the male plug out of its socket.

    • Using the same spudger's flat side pry around the two dies. The old thermal paste will fight back so take your time.

    • Carefully remove the display cable concealed with plastic on the leftmost side of the board - marked in blue.

    • Remove the wifi coax cables (black and white) concealed with plastic to the rightmost side of the board - marked in pink.

    • Only then the cooling unit can be freely removed.

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Cleaning and appling the paste: шаг 4, изображение 1 из 3 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Cleaning and appling the paste: шаг 4, изображение 2 из 3 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, Cleaning and appling the paste: шаг 4, изображение 3 из 3
    • You can see where the thermal paste was so make sure to apply it on the same surfaces.

    • I have marked two small parts that are easy to miss.

    • I used 70% rubbing alcohol, tissues, and the flat end of a spudger to remove the old paste.

    • I used a plastic spudger to spread the paste on the chips to make sure that it will make full contact.

    • Replace the cooler by reversing the steps in step 3.

  5. Asus ROG Zephyrus G14 Thermal Paste Replacement, The bottom case: шаг 6, изображение 1 из 1
    • Button up the device by placing and screwing on the bottom case.

    • The screws marked in orange are long. The ones marked in red are short.
